Why the Forehead Is Prone to “Puffiness”

The forehead’s thin subcutaneous fat layer (averaging 1.2–2.5 mm thickness) and high mobility make it uniquely sensitive to filler distribution. Injecting too superficially—within the dermis or superficial fat—increases the risk of visible lumps. Data from the International Society of Aesthetic Plastic Surgery (ISAPS) shows that 12% of forehead filler revisions involve correcting superficial placement. Additionally, hyaluronic acid fillers with high water-binding capacity (e.g., Juvéderm Voluma) may expand up to 25% post-injection in humid climates, exacerbating puffiness if not accounted for.

Advanced Injection Techniques for Seamless Blending

Experienced practitioners use these methods to prevent puffiness:

  1. Supraperiosteal Layering: Depositing filler deep near the bone (periosteum) creates structural support without surface bulging. A 2022 cadaver study confirmed this layer absorbs 68% less product movement compared to subcutaneous injections.
  2. Microbolus Strategy: Administering 0.01–0.03 mL aliquots every 5–7 mm allows even dispersion. Over 80% of practitioners in a Dermal Market Forehead Volumizers Guide-cited survey found this method reduced revision rates by 40%.
  3. Dynamic Assessment: Observing the forehead during eyebrow elevation and frowning helps identify overfilled zones. Real-time ultrasound imaging shows improper filler distribution in 23% of cases during static evaluations alone.

Post-Treatment Protocols: The 72-Hour Rule

Immediate aftercare significantly impacts results:

  • Hour 0–24: Apply ice packs intermittently (15 mins/hour) to reduce initial swelling. Avoid NSAIDs—they increase bruising risk by 33%.
  • Hour 24–48: Sleep at a 30° angle to minimize fluid accumulation. Patients who maintained elevation had 27% less morning puffiness per ultrasound measurements.
  • Hour 48–72: Gentle lymphatic massage (2–3x daily) using vertical strokes toward temples enhances drainage. A 2021 RCT demonstrated a 39% reduction in residual swelling with this technique.
